The Window Right at the Roadhouse

Michelle Hussey (gig: 15/01/07)
With momentary nods to Pink Floyd and Doves, The Window Right pushed along a vocal-less journey compromising of all kinds of surprising elements.

The Window Right
The Window Right

With leading bass lines and soft guitar dipping in and out of dreamlike tones to sharper melody driven riffs, this sometimes haphazard, sometimes too perfect for words set was an absolute pleasure to listen to.

There was the occasional feeling of intruding on a practice session, possibly due to how relaxed the trio seem on stage, but no sooner are you lulled into that than they throw something at you to get you completely engaged and engrossed. It’s the reason why TWR have huge potential to become complete masters of their art. 

They’re close enough already and the beauty of it is you can tell they just want to keep experimenting. Divided between Manchester and Leeds, The Window Right are sometimes are little difficult to catch, but it’s worth the effort to let them into your life.
